概括
区块链技术在医疗保健中提供了增强的医疗数据安全性和隐私. 它解决了数据保护和互操作性的挑战,使患者和提供者能够安全地交换信息.

背景情况:
- 医疗保健行业面临着COVID-19后的挑战,包括成本上升和技术更新的需求.
- 数字平台和颠覆性技术正在彻底改变医疗保健系统,但它们对行业的影响需要进一步了解.
- 人口健康管理应对数据保护,共享和互操作性等关键问题,特别是在个性化医疗和可穿戴设备方面.
研究的目的:
- 探索区块链技术在医疗保健中的变革潜力和当前应用.
- 确定区块链如何解决医疗数据管理,安全和互操作性的关键挑战.
- 检查将区块链集成到医疗保健生态系统的前进道路.
主要方法:
- 审查区块链技术原则及其在医疗保健中的应用.
- 对区块链在保护和管理医疗数据方面的现有和潜在用例的分析.
- 讨论区块链在增强数据完整性,透明度,隐私和监管合规方面的作用.
主要成果:
- 区块链技术提供了一个分散的,不可变的分类账,以提高医疗数据的安全性,完整性,透明度和隐私.
- 它可以实现精细的访问控制,提高互操作性,并提供对网络攻击的抵抗力.
- 区块链可以简化监管合规,促进敏感健康信息的安全记录,传输和访问.
结论:
- 区块链技术为医疗保健中的关键数据保护,共享和互操作性挑战提供了可行的解决方案.
- 它的实施可以显著提高患者数据安全性,并促进无,安全的信息交换.
- 区块链集成是医疗保健转型的关键途径,解决现代复杂性并改善患者的治疗结果.

The issues and trends in healthcare delivery are constantly changing. The COVID-19 pandemic is one recent issue that wreaked havoc on healthcare systems, causing a shortage of healthcare workers, high demand for medicines and supplies, and increased medical expenditure due to a lack of insurance. Other issues include rising healthcare costs and care fragmentation.

An integrated healthcare system (IHS) is a set of organizations that provides for or arranges to provide coordinated and continuous service to a defined population. The IHS takes responsibility for that particular population's health status and outcome, both clinically and fiscally. An integrated healthcare system is a well-organized, well-coordinated, and collaborative network. Secondary healthcare is offered by a specialist, generally in hospitals or clinics for patients referred by primary healthcare providers. It occurs when a person has an illness or injury that requires specific medical care. Secondary care is often referred to as acute care. Secondary care can range from uncomplicated care to repair a minor laceration or treat a strep throat infection to more complicated emergent care, such as treating a head injury sustained in an automobile accident.
